We are thinking of taking a verandah guarantee for June 22nd sailing on silhouette. Has anyone done this recently? There is a big price difference (almost $1000pp) if we do this vs. taking an assigned room. We are elite. Anyone out there have any thoughts or experiences?

We booked a guarantee balcony for our May cruise and it worked out very well, we have been given a CC cabin on resort deck, now to some it may not be the best cabin as it is shaded and under the ocean view bar but we are more than happy, I expected an obstructed view, my sister booked the same and she was assigned a CC cabin right on the back overlooking the wake.

 

This is the first time I have booked a guarantee so I don't know of it was first time lucky or not but for the saving I would do it again even if I didn't get a brilliant cabin, £1000 is a lot of money to save, it is another cruise !

It will be Ok if you are prepared to receive an obstructed or partially obstructed cabin. I can’t recall all the cabin codes, but we were assigned the second to the lowest category. I think it was 2C and perhaps 2D is the most obstructed. Judging by the assigned category, it does not appear that our CC status helped any. We also did an AQ guarantee and received an AQ cabin in a decent location.

 

Please do not take any guarantee if the cabin location or deck are important to you.

 

We sail often and cabin location is not too important ( just the major category like veranda, AQ , suite etc).

 

We take a guarantee if the savings is substantial.
